What is Root Canal Treatment?

Root canal is a dental procedure used to treat infection or damage inside the tooth’s pulp. The pulp contains nerves and blood vessels that help the tooth develop. When bacteria reach this inner layer of the tooth due to decay, cracks, or trauma, it can cause severe pain and infection. However, a constant toothache or sensitivity to heat doesn’t always mean an extraction.

During a root canal treatment in Dubai, the dentist removes the infected pulp, thoroughly cleans and disinfects the inside of the tooth, and then seals and restores it with a filling or crown. This preserves the natural tooth structure while restoring normal function.

Saving your natural tooth helps maintain proper bite alignment and prevents the need for extraction or tooth replacement procedures.

The root canal treatment in Dubai Dental Clinic is no more uncomfortable than a standard filling. In most cases, the root canal specialist completes it in one or two visits. Simple cases can often be handled in a single visit, while more complex infections may require a second appointment to ensure the area is fully sterile before sealing.

Step 1 – Diagnosis and Digital Imaging

Your dentist in Dubai for a root canal will evaluate the tooth and take digital X-rays to determine the extent of infection and plan the treatment.

Step 2 – Removing the Infection

The root canal specialist will then carefully remove the infected pulp inside the tooth and then clean, shape, and disinfect the affected tooth to eliminate bacteria.

Step 3 – Sealing the Tooth

A biocompatible material is filled in the cleaned canals to prevent reinfection.

Step 4 – Restoring the Tooth

In many cases, a dental crown is placed on the treated tooth to restore its strength and function. You may feel slight tenderness for 24–48 hours, which is easily managed with over-the-counter medication. Most patients return to their normal Dubai lifestyle the very next day.
